My 05 Jeep Liberty shakes when I am accelerating past 40 MPH and gets worse as I reach 60 MPH. Its the entire Jeep that shakes and only when I am accelerating. It doesn't shake under 40 MPH nor when I have my foot off the gas pedal. Could this be a transfer case or CV joint problem? If not, any idea what it might be?

The first things you will want to check are the flex joints on both your drive shafts. A CV joint can be bad enough to vibrate yet, you still can't shake it like a regular U joint. So you need to look at them carefully. Also, it could be a drive axle joint or even a tire out of round with cord seperation.
